So I've just recently gotten my NT (northern territory) drivers license just in case I ever need to take the car somewhere. It only costs $24 and it all I had to do was show some paperwork (passport, US drivers license, proof of address) and take an eye test. There was no road test or even book test hahah! Which is perfectly fine with me, the only thing they really do different over here is drive on the left hand side of the road, most everything else is the same. Still though it seemed wayyyyyyy toooooo easy to get a license, I could be a TERRIBLE driver (WHICH is obviously not true, I have a pefectly clean driving record :) ) in the US and they wouldn't have any idea! Craziness, but at least it wasn't a hassle.
